Why an immigration law firm needs a focused local website
Immigration clients usually search with a problem in mind, not a brand name. They may look for help after a visa denial, a court notice, or a family petition question. That is why a seo website for a immigration lawyer business must explain your services in plain language and show where you practice. A generic law firm homepage often hides the details people need. If you handle asylum in one city and family immigration in another nearby area, say so clearly. A practical step is to map your top three client types and build one page for each, so visitors can find the right path quickly.
What services, proof, and trust signals your site should show
Your site should make it easy to understand what cases you handle and why someone should contact you. Include service pages for citizenship, green card applications, deportation defense, visa issues, and family petitions. Add attorney bios, office address, bar admissions, language support, and a short explanation of your process. For example, a client searching for asylum help wants to know whether you handle urgent filings and court representation. If you have client testimonials, use them carefully and honestly. You can also add a simple FAQ about documents, timelines, and consultation expectations. The practical action here is to review each service page and ask whether a nervous client would trust you after reading it.
How to turn visitors into consultation requests
An immigration website should reduce hesitation and make the next step obvious. Place a consultation request form, phone number, and email link near the top of the page, then repeat them after service descriptions. If you handle urgent matters, such as notices to appear or deadline-driven filings, your contact section should explain how quickly someone can reach your office. A clear call to action helps people move from reading to acting. You should also decide what information to ask for, such as case type, city, and preferred language, so your team can respond efficiently. How local SEO and service area pages help people find you
Local visibility matters because most clients want a lawyer they can reach in their city or nearby area. Build pages around real service areas, such as downtown, surrounding suburbs, or nearby counties you actually serve. Use the city name naturally in page titles, headings, and office details. If someone searches why my immigration lawyer website is not ranking on google, the answer is often that the site does not clearly connect services to location. A useful step is to create one page per location and make sure each page includes the office address, nearby landmarks, and the specific immigration matters you handle there. That helps both visitors and search engines understand relevance.
Design, photos, and page structure that build confidence
Immigration clients often decide quickly whether a site feels professional and trustworthy. Use a clean layout, readable fonts, and real office photos instead of generic stock images when possible. A homepage should lead with your main practice areas, then move into proof, FAQs, and contact options. For example, a person looking for help with a marriage-based green card should see that service before scrolling through unrelated content. If you have case examples, describe them in a privacy-safe way, such as common filing situations or typical client concerns, rather than personal details. A practical action is to review your homepage on mobile and make sure the first screen answers who you help, where you work, and how to contact you.

Common mistakes immigration lawyers make with their websites
Hiding practice areas behind vague language
If your homepage only says you are a law firm, visitors may not know whether you handle asylum, family petitions, or removal defense. Spell out the cases you take so people can self-qualify quickly.
Ignoring city and service area pages
A single homepage is rarely enough for local search. If you serve multiple cities, create separate pages for each real location or service area instead of expecting one page to rank everywhere.
Forgetting the consultation path
Some firms explain everything but never make it easy to contact them. Put phone, email, and a consultation request form where visitors can find them without hunting through the site.
Using generic photos and weak trust signals
Stock images and missing attorney details can make a site feel impersonal. Add real office photos, attorney bios, bar admissions, and clear office information so clients know who they are hiring.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I build a website for an immigration lawyer business that can rank locally?
Focus on clear practice areas, city-specific pages, and strong contact details. Search engines need to understand where you work and what cases you handle. Add attorney bios, office information, and FAQs that answer real client questions. Then keep the site updated when your services or service areas change.
Why my immigration lawyer website is not showing on google?
Common reasons include thin content, unclear location signals, missing service pages, and a site that does not explain your practice areas well. If your pages do not mention the cities you serve or the cases you handle, search engines may not know when to show them. Review your page titles, headings, and office details.
What should be on a local seo for immigration lawyers page?
A good page should explain the specific immigration services you provide, the city or area you serve, your office contact details, and a clear next step for consultation. Add FAQs about documents, timelines, and common concerns. If possible, include a short attorney bio and trust signals that help visitors feel comfortable reaching out.
Do immigration lawyers need service area pages for a immigration lawyer website?
Yes, if you serve more than one city or county, service area pages can help people find the right office or nearby help. Each page should be written for that location, not copied from another page. Include the local area name, the services offered there, and a practical contact option.
